Hospitals Building Programme.

Dáil Éireann Debate, Thursday - 26 October 2006

Thursday, 26 October 2006

Questions (112)

Joe Costello

Question:

111 Mr. Costello asked the Minister for Health and Children the number of sites on the grounds of public hospitals that she has identified for the construction of private hospitals; the estimated market value of the sites; the financial terms under which the sites will be disposed of to the private sector; the bed capacity of the proposed private sector development; and if she will make a statement on the matter. [34943/06]

View answer

Written answers

The HSE is currently engaged in a procurement process with the private sector to build and operate private hospitals on 10 public hospital sites. This will enable up to 1,000 beds in public hospitals, which are currently used by private patients, to be re-designated for use by public patients. Proposals will be subject to detailed evaluation by the HSE. The procedure will also provide for a rigorous value for money assessment of any proposal and will take account of the value of the public site and the cost of any tax foregone. Any transaction will be on a commercial basis and will fully protect the public interest. In addition, there will be full adherence to public procurement law and best practice.
